Ukraine’s President warns of the risk of “cancelling all negotiations” with Russia

“I insist that the removal of our troops, our people, will put an end to all negotiations,” Zelensky told the media. Ukraine on April 17 and emphasized – “This will be a stalemate because we will not exchange our territory or our people for peace.”

The statement of the President of Ukraine took place in the context that Russia on April 16 confirmed that it had “completely occupied” the strategic city of Mariupol.

The Russian Defense Ministry said there are still “remnants” of Ukrainian forces hiding in the Azovstal metallurgical plant.

“The only chance to save their lives is to voluntarily surrender their guns” – radio station RT quoted Major General Igor Konashenkov, a spokesman for the Russian Ministry of Defense, emphasizing and adding that Ukrainian forces fighting in Mariupol will be guaranteed their lives if they lay down their weapons between 6-13 hours (local time). side) on April 17.

The Russian-Ukrainian conflict has entered its 53rd day and for nearly two months the two sides have been having a tense confrontation in Mariupol, southern Ukraine. This is a strategic city on the coast of Azov, a corridor on the border between the Crimean peninsula and the breakaway region in eastern Ukraine. If it controls this location, Russia can establish a land corridor between Russia and the Donbas and Crimea regions as well as fully control the Sea of ​​Azov.

Contrary to Russia’s statement, the Kiev side insists that their troops are still holding the strategic port city of Mariupol, according to the British newspaper. Independent.

Referring to a town outside Kiev that has been ravaged by shelling, Mr Zelensky said: “There are more places like Borodyanka that will make negotiations more difficult, more distant.”

In Kiev, mayor Vitali Klitscho said that Ukrainians who have left the capital in recent weeks should not now return home.

Russia stepped up its air strikes in the Kiev region on April 16. Authorities in the capital Kiev and the western city of Lviv have confirmed explosions in this area, according to Independent.
